Description:
We are seeking highly qualified and experienced Lecturers to join our Computer Science department.
The successful candidate will have a Master's degree in Computer Science, along with a passion for teaching and a desire to help students achieve their full potential. This position offers a competitive pay package and attractive remuneration.
Responsibilities:
- Develop and deliver lectures, tutorials, and practical classes in Computer Science to undergraduate students.
- Design and develop course materials, including syllabi, course outlines, and teaching aids.
- Evaluate student progress through examinations, tests, assignments, and other assessment methods.
- Provide academic guidance and support to students, including advising on course selection, academic performance, and career options.
- Engage in research and scholarship activities, including publishing research papers, attending conferences, and keeping up to date with the latest developments in the field.
- Participate in departmental meetings, program reviews, and other academic activities.
Qualifications:
- Master's degree in Computer Science or a related field.
- Excellent communication and presentation skills, with the ability to explain complex concepts in a clear and concise manner.
- Passion for teaching and a desire to help students achieve their full potential.
- Ability to work collaboratively with colleagues and other stakeholders.
- Demonstrated expertise in one or more areas of Computer Science, such as programming, software engineering, database systems, computer networks, or artificial intelligence.